CELSIUS has entered a partnership with 23XI Racing, with the premium, functional energy drink serving as an Official Partner and the Exclusive Energy Drink and Energy-Providing Product for Corey Heim and the No. 67 Toyota Camry XSE in the NASCAR Cup Series.

As part of the relationship, CELSIUS branding will be present with Corey Heim, the defending champion of the NASCAR Craftsman Truck Series, and the No. 67 Toyota Camry XSE, 23XI Racing’s fourth NASCAR Cup Series entry, throughout the year.

The highlight of the partnership, though, will come in late August, when CELSIUS serves as the primary sponsor for Heim’s NASCAR Cup Series entry into the Summer event at Daytona International Speedway on August 29.

“We’re proud to have CELSIUS on board to support Corey [Heim] and the No. 67 team this season,” said Steve Lauletta, Team President of 23XI Racing. “CELSIUS has been a key supporter of Corey, and we look forward to working together as Corey and the team continue to grow and progress.”

As an associate partner of Heim, the first-ever development driver for 23XI Racing, CELSIUS will be prominently featured on the No. 67 team’s uniforms, equipment, pit box, and hauler, as well as on Heim’s driver uniform.

In his second season under the developmental guise of 23XI Racing, Heim is scheduled to run a 12-race campaign in the NASCAR Cup Series, beginning with the season-opening DAYTONA 500, as well as select events in the NASCAR Craftsman Truck Series.

“I’m very grateful to continue my relationship with CELSIUS and look forward to representing the brand when the No. 67 team races this season,” said Corey Heim, driver of the No. 67 Toyota Camry XSE. “Whether it’s on the track or off, CELSIUS has been a great partner, and I’m excited to have them alongside me again for what I expect will be a memorable season.”

The native of Marietta, Georgia, is considered to be one of NASCAR’s most talented prospects, having spent the last three seasons dominating the NASCAR Craftsman Truck Series in the No. 11 Toyota Tundra TRD Pro for TRICON Garage, resulting in an impressive 23 victories, 51 top-fives, and 68 top-10s in 89 starts.

The kick-off to Heim’s 2026 NASCAR Cup Series campaign will be the DAYTONA 500 at Daytona International Speedway, taking place on Sunday, February 15 at 2:30 PM ET on FOX, Motor Racing Network, and SiriusXM NASCAR Radio Channel 90.
